The Science Behind Our Pool Leak Water Removal Process
Proper water removal needs a detailed, step-by-step approach to ensure your property is thoroughly dried and restored. Our team follows a tried-and-true process that involves:
Step 1: Emergency Inspection and Assessment
We’ll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age. Our crew will identify the source of the leak. We’ll provide a comprehensive report, outlining the recommended course of action.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ract standing water. Our technicians will remove saturated materials and dry out the affected area. No mess left behind.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-capacity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ry the space. Our equipment will help prevent mold growth and secondary damage. A dry environment is just the beginning.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
We’ll disinfect and sanitize the affected area to prevent bacterial growth. Our team will meticulously clean and restore the space to its original condition. No hidden mess, no doubt.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Reporting
We’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and restored. Our crew will provide a detailed report, outlining the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ance. We stand behind our work.

Pool Leak Water Removal Cost in Spanish Fork, UT
The cost of Pool Leak Water Removal in Spanish Fork, UT var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a customized quote after assessing the damage. No hidden fees or surprises. Just honest, upfront pricing.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Inspection |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The amount of water, the type of equipment needed, and the complexity of the job.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the duration of the drying process. |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the contamination, the type of cleaning products needed, and the complexity of the job. |
| Final Inspection and Reporting |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the job, the type of equipment needed, and the duration of the inspection. |
